Do you wake up in the middle of the night, suddenly seized by enormous pangs of guilt for all the noxious emissions you've contributed to the atmosphere with all your driving? Neither do we. But one could argue--from an ecological point of view--that the automobile is one of the lousiest things mankind has ever invented. Let's face it: No one thing has ruined more cities, killed more people, caused more pollution, and caused us to be more sedentary than the automobile. Just being responsible for strip malls should itself be enough to get the car on most fecal rosters. If it weren't for the lucrative career we've had fixing them, automobiles would have no redeeming qualities whatsoever. ![]() Thankfully, there are some things you can do to reduce the impact of the automobile on the environment.
